India News: Punjab CM Bhagwant Mann has declared a financial aid of Rs 1 crore for the family of Shubhakaran Singh, who lost his life during the ongoing farmers' protest at Khanauri border. The announcement also includes a government job for Shubhakaran Singh's younger sister, with the assurance of appropriate legal action against the responsible individuals.

Haryana Police in Ambala district revoked the National Security Act (NSA), 1980 against farmers unions and protestors. The law was imposed due to daily attempts by unions to break barricades at the Shambhu border and damage to government and private property. The NSA allows for preventive detention in certain cases.
